Eco Boss Cap:
Our Flagship Solution

The Eco Boss Cap is an innovative propeller enhancement designed to reduce fuel consumption, improve propulsion efficiency, and cut emissions. By eliminating propeller hub vortex cavitation, it optimises water flow, leading to up to 5% fuel savings and reduced operational costs for shipowners.

This cost-effective and easy-to-retrofit solution supports compliance with IMO environmental regulations while enhancing vessel performance.

How It Works

The Eco Boss Cap enhances the flow of water around the propeller by eliminating vortex cavitation, improving the propeller’s efficiency. This results in a reduction in drag and improved fuel efficiency.

3.1%

Propeller Efficiency

1.1%

Thrust

-2.0%

Torque

-10%

Cavitation at Rudder
